Common Issues and Errors Related to npdbsignweb.dll
D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.
- Npdbsignweb.dll Access Violation: This message indicates that a program has tried to access memory that it shouldn't. It could be caused by software bugs, outdated drivers, or conflicts between software.
- Npdbsignweb.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error typically signifies that the DLL file may be incompatible with your version of Windows, or it's corrupted. It can also occur if you're trying to run a DLL file meant for a different system architecture (for instance, a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system).
- Cannot register npdbsignweb.dll: This suggests that the DLL file could not be registered by the system, possibly due to inconsistencies or errors in the Windows Registry. Another reason might be that the DLL file is not in the correct directory or is missing.
- This application failed to start because npdbsignweb.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
- Npdbsignweb.dll not found: The required DLL file is absent from the expected directory. This can result from software uninstalls, updates, or system changes that mistakenly remove or relocate DLL files.

Perform a System Restore to Fix Dll Errors
In this guide, we provide steps to perform a System Restore.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
System Restore
in the search bar and press Enter. -
Click on Create a restore point.
-
In the System Properties window, under the System Protection tab, click on System Restore....
-
Click Next in the System Restore window.
-
Choose a restore point from the list. Ideally, select a point when you know the system was working well.
